Camille Manfredi is Professor of Scottish Literature and Visual Arts and Director of the Heritage and Creation in Text and Image (HCTI) research laboratory at the University of Brest's College of Arts, Letters and Civilizations. She serves as Director of the English LLCER Department and leads the Master 2 Research program in Arts, Letters and Civilizations with Texts, Images and Foreign Languages specialization.
Her academic credentials include a Habilitation to Direct Research from Aix-Marseille University (2017), a PhD from the University of Nantes (2005), and the Agrégation (2000). Her research spans contemporary Scottish literature and visual arts (20th-21st centuries), with particular focus on cultural nationalism, intermediality, and environmental humanities. She explores word-image-sound relationships through film poetry, photo-literature, and environmental studies including geocriticism and ecocriticism.
Manfredi's recent publications reveal strong thematic continuity in Scottish cultural production, with increasing emphasis on environmental emergency and intermedial resilience. Her collaborative projects like Intermedial Art Practices as Cultural Resilience (2023) and the Edinburgh Companion to Alasdair Gray demonstrate her leadership in transnational Scottish studies. The recurring focus on waterscapes, apocalypse narratives, and cultural memory indicates her commitment to understanding Scotland through ecological and visual frameworks.
She actively contributes to academic discourse through editorial roles including co-editing thematic issues of E-Rea on environmental emergency and relational studies, and serves as elected member of Section 11 of the CNU (National Council of Universities).
Manfredi's teaching portfolio encompasses Scottish Studies (Culture/Society), British Literature, aesthetic theories, media history, reception theories, and intermediality across undergraduate and graduate levels. Her administrative responsibilities include departmental leadership and laboratory direction within the HCTI research unit.
